2012-02-29 120 views
0

我想知道一些事情。來自網站的Android數據庫

我有一個數據庫3行,我必須使用我的網站上的數據庫,因爲它必須與每一個下載我的應用程序,因爲他們可以添加更多的東西共享。

表被稱爲

POKA

,並且行是 - ID - 字(TEXT) - 答覆(TEXT)

該回覆被鉤到的單詞。

感覺可以有多於1個相同的「單詞」文本我需要它來搜索扔在EditText輸入的每個單詞,並從中選擇一個隨機回覆,並顯示在EditText中。如果沒有詞,它會說找不到一個。

+0

你在想什麼? – zmbq 2012-02-29 06:49:07

+0

我怎麼能做到我上面說的? – user1239315 2012-02-29 06:49:43

+0

這取決於您使用哪個數據庫,哪個Web應用程序框架? – zmbq 2012-02-29 06:51:12

回答

0

因爲只要文本框更改的值調用提供響應的Web服務,就必須使用文本框編輯偵聽器,這取決於您發送給它的內容,然後將該響應傳遞給文本框。 參考refer the answer of the question

在上面的鏈接我解釋了與代碼的答案。使用該代碼,你絕對可以做到這一點。 最主要的是構建Web服務,以便它給予適當的響應。只需從Web服務返回單詞表,然後捕獲該表即可獲取相關列數據並將其顯示在您的應用程序中。

obj3.getProperty(0).toString();//id 
obj3.getProperty(1).toString();//word 

如果返回ID和字NAD你想只有一個字列,那麼你可以選擇

obj3.getProperty(1).toString();//word 

所有的答案是解釋上述link.refer這一點。 如果您遇到更多問題,請寫評論。

+0

我在文本「prm_value」下得到一個錯誤,說prm_value無法解析爲變量 – user1239315 2012-02-29 21:23:29

+0

request.addProperty(「parm_name」,prm_value); //方法 – user1239315 2012-02-29 21:23:47

+0

的參數確保parm_name與web服務中的parameter_name相同,並且prm_value類型必須與web服務中的類型匹配** ex:假設web服務中的emp_sal類型是「String」,並且在我們的程序中它是Double,所以我們需要將它轉換爲String請求。方法addProperty( 「emp_sal」,將String.valueOf(34444)); ** – 2012-03-02 04:57:01

相關問題